arXiv:2608.04243v1 Announce Type: new Abstract: Multi-head attention layers produce vector representations that support multiple downstream tasks. We establish bounds on the number of heads required in two simple and concrete multi-task scenarios. In the first scenario, a vector representation is sought so that linear predictors can compute both the smallest and largest numbers in a given list.
